My priority code never changed from a 19. I ordered a base XL hybrid on 8/20, and was scheduled for production week of 11/22. It looks as though it is based only on dealer allocations and what the regional manager is told what is planned for those week build schedules to choose from the orders. Its a gamble on supply right down to cargo hooks, seat material, paint, plastic, even nuts and bolts. For 2 weeks they will schedule hybrid orders with white paint because they have enough on hand to do them. Then they have to wait 2 weeks because hybrid motor mounts or electric motors are 2 weeks away for delivery. Next batch will be cactus ecoboost with lariat seats because that stuff is scheduled to be on site on that week. Your dealer may have 0 allocations for 1 week then get only 2 the next and none of the orders match the regional plan for that week's build plan due to supply constraints. Ford is still trying to build what they can with what they have and the dealers are spinning the wheel each week hoping it lands on one of their customers orders. Look forward to even more shut down days simply due to the supply problems. I may have a production week but it's a long way off and I'm not getting excited until it's in the driveway. My dealership told me they can enter the orders with a status of 10 - the highest value a dealership can set. When they enter the order the priority code defaults to 19, but the dealership can set it to 10. I heard the same on the youtube videos from Long MacArthur in Kansas - they create a lot of content on the ordering process.


- minute 4 starts the explanation of order priotity code. Dealership should set to 10, not 19.
